BlackRock Inc. bought a new stake in Foghorn Therapeutics Inc. (NASDAQ:FHTX - Free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m bought 2,626,832 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$12,819,000. BlackRock Inc. owned about 4.47% of Foghorn Therapeutics at the end of the most recent quarter.

Several other large investors also recently made changes to their positions in FHTX. Candriam S.C.A. purchased a new position in shares of Foghorn Therapeutics in the first quarter valued at $1,500,000. Renaissance Technologies LLC increased its holdings in Foghorn Therapeutics by 151.8% during the 4th quarter. Renaissance Technologies LLC now owns 297,736 shares of the company's stock worth $1,608,000 after purchasing an additional 179,500 shares during the last quarter. Millennium Management LLC raised its position in shares of Foghorn Therapeutics by 861.6% in the 3rd quarter. Millennium Management LLC now owns 178,791 shares of the company's stock valued at $874,000 after purchasing an additional 160,197 shares in the last quarter. Raymond James Financial Inc. boosted its stake in shares of Foghorn Therapeutics by 6.7% during the 2nd quarter. Raymond James Financial Inc. now owns 2,367,292 shares of the company's stock valued at $11,126,000 after buying an additional 148,940 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Geode Capital Management LLC boosted its stake in shares of Foghorn Therapeutics by 16.9% during the 2nd qu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C now owns 807,674 shares of the company's stock valued at $3,797,000 after buying an additional 116,979 shares during the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 61.55% of the company's stock.

Foghorn Therapeutics Stock Up 1.0%

Shares of FHTX opened at $4.92 on Friday. The stock's 50-day moving average price is $5.65 and its 200 day moving average price is $5.05. The firm has a market capitalization of $292.15 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-5.02 and a beta of 2.86. Foghorn Therapeutics Inc. has a 12-month low of $3.27 and a 12-month high of $7.61.

Foghorn Therapeutics (NASDAQ:FHTX -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 6th. The company reported ($0.10) ear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.24) by $0.14. The business had revenue of $16.10 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$6.80 million. Equities research analysts expect that Foghorn Therapeutics Inc. will post -0.81 EPS for the current year.

Foghorn Therapeutics Profile

(Free Report)

Foghorn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on the discovery and development of novel epigenetic therapies for cancer. The company leverages its proprietary Targeted Protein Discovery Platform to identify and design small-molecule inhibitors that modulate chromatin regulatory proteins involved in tumor growth and survival. By targeting the mechanisms that control gene expression, Foghorn seeks to address unmet needs in oncology through precision medicine.

The company's lead candidate, FHD-286, is a selective inhibitor of variant SWI/SNF chromatin remodeling complexes and is currently being evaluated in Phase 1 clinical trials for patients with solid tumors harboring specific SMARCA2 and SMARCA4 alterations.
